What is an Island Extractor Fan?
An island extractor fan is a kind of kitchen appliance installed on the ceiling above an island cooking area. Unlike conventional wall-mounted range hoods, which are installed against a wall, island extractors hang directly above the cooking surface area of a kitchen island. They are designed to remove smoke, steam, odors, and airborne grease through ventilation systems, making sure a fresher and cleaner kitchen environment.

Selecting the best island extractor fan for your kitchen includes a number of considerations. Here's a list of factors to bear in mind when making your option:
Size and Dimensions: The fan ought to cover the entire cooking area. A general rule of thumb is to pick a fan that is at least the same width as the cooktop for optimum performance.
Ventilation Type:
Ducted: Expels air outside, suitable for those looking for ultimate performance.Ductless: Recycles air back into the kitchen utilizing filters, best for locations where ducting is unwise.
Suction Power (CFM): Measured in cubic feet per minute (CFM), this shows how effectively the fan can remove air. Preferably, pick a fan with a minimum of 600 CFM for an island cooktop.
Sound Level: Look for designs with a low sone rating (a system of measurement for perceived loudness) for quieter operation, especially during high-speed settings.
Filter Type and Maintenance:
Aluminum Filters: Durable and simple to clean.Charcoal Filters: Typically found in ductless designs; these requirement replacement routinely.
Design and Aesthetics: Match the extractor's style with your kitchen decoration. Think about materials like stainless steel, glass, or perhaps custom wood surfaces.
Lighting: Integrated LED lights enhance functionality and visibility over the cooktop.

How frequently should I clean the filters?
It is recommended to clean up the filters routinely, usually every 1-3 months, depending upon usage. Charcoal filters need to be changed according to the maker's guidelines.
2. Are island extractor fans noisy?
The sound level differs by model. Look for fans with a lower sone score for quieter operation.
3. Can I set up an island extractor fan myself?
While some property owners may choose to do it themselves, hiring an expert is often suggested for appropriate setup, particularly when handling electrical and ducting systems.
4. Do I require a ducted or ductless extractor fan?
Choose a ducted model for exceptional efficiency if possible. A ductless unit may be ideal for homes or areas where ducting isn't feasible.
5. How do I calculate the right CFM for my kitchen?
A basic guideline is to enable 100 CFM for every single direct foot of the cooking surface. For instance, for a 3-foot cooktop, try to find a fan with a minimum of 300 CFM.
